Technical Infrastructure: The Twin Turbo Engine for Prediction Markets

Sei's technical architecture is a masterclass in speed and scalability. Its Twin Turbo consensus mechanism achieves block finality in 300 milliseconds, a critical feature for prediction markets where rapid settlement of bets and outcomes is paramount.

, Sei's throughput of 12,500 transactions per second (TPS) outperforms most Layer 1s in handling high-frequency trading and real-time data processing.

The upcoming Giga Upgrade in 2025 promises to amplify these capabilities further. By introducing Autobahn consensus and asynchronous execution, the upgrade aims to scale throughput to 200,000+ TPS and reduce finality times to sub-400 milliseconds

. This leap in performance directly addresses the pain points of prediction markets-latency, slippage, and front-running-while enabling seamless integration with DeFi event contracts. For context, Solana's 50,000 TPS and 400ms finality pale in comparison to Sei's projected metrics .

DEX Volume Surge: A Barometer of Ecosystem Health

Sei's DEX volume has surged to $43 million per day in late 2025, with a 30-day cumulative volume of $411.7 million

. This growth is underpinned by a 93.5% quarter-over-quarter increase in active addresses (824,000) and 2 million daily transactions .
Notably, game-related transactions alone hit 116 million, signaling robust engagement in sectors that often overlap with prediction markets .

The network's TVL efficiency-ranking fourth globally-further underscores its appeal. A TVL of $600 million supports over $38 billion in perpetual trading volume, a testament to Sei's ability to optimize capital utilization

. This efficiency is critical for prediction markets, where liquidity depth and low slippage are non-negotiable.

Altseason Momentum and DeFi Event Contracts

The current altseason is being fueled by DeFi event contracts, which thrive on Sei's high-speed execution and parallelized EVM. Protocols like Yei Finance and Takara Lend have seen TVL growth of 90.5% and 374.9% respectively in Q2 2025, driven by innovations like YeiSwap and DragonSwap's token genesis event

. These developments highlight Sei's role as a launchpad for DeFi-native prediction markets and event-driven liquidity pools.

Moreover, Sei's dual smart contract environments (EVM and CosmWasm) enable developers to leverage Ethereum's mature ecosystem while benefiting from Sei's speed

. This hybrid model is a strategic advantage in a market where interoperability and execution efficiency are king.
